Recording a Deed or Document in Aleutians East Borough, AK
Aleutians East Borough (population 3,479) records real-property documents through the State of Alaska DNR Recorder's Office - Anchorage Recording Office (Aleutian Islands Recording District). Aleutians East Borough recording — the essentials
- Recording office
- State of Alaska DNR Recorder's Office - Anchorage Recording Office (Aleutian Islands Recording District)
- Recording fee
- $20.00 first page first / $5.00 per additional page add'l (+$50 Non-Standard Document fee (if margins/format not met); $2.00 per indexed name over six; $5.00 certification fee; plat/survey first sheet $20, additional sheet $5)
- Mailing address
- 550 West 7th Ave, Suite 108, Anchorage, AK 99501-3564
- Phone
- (907) 269-8875 / (907) 269-8876
- Checks payable to
- Department of Natural Resources
- Electronic recording
- Available via Simplifile, CSC, ePN
Formatting note: No statutory cover-sheet mandate found; document must meet AS 40.17.030 formal requisites (see formatting_notes) or pay $50 non-standard fee

How to record a document in Aleutians East Borough, Alaska
- Prepare the document so it meets Aleutians East Borough formatting rules (legal description, grantee address, signature block, and the blank margin the recorder reserves for its stamp).
- Notarize it if the instrument requires acknowledgment — most deeds and affidavits do.
- Submit electronically through Simplifile, CSC, ePN, or by mail to State of Alaska DNR Recorder's Office - Anchorage Recording Office (Aleutian Islands Recording District) at 550 West 7th Ave, Suite 108, Anchorage, AK 99501-3564.
- Pay the recording fee ($20.00 first page first / $5.00 per additional page add'l (+$50 Non-Standard Document fee (if margins/format not met); $2.00 per indexed name over six; $5.00 certification fee; plat/survey first sheet $20, additional sheet $5)).
- Receive the recorded instrument back with its book/page or instrument number as proof of record.
